We are developing a fiber optic probe-based dual-beam interferometer for measuring subnanometer displacements of surfaces without need for a separate reference surface. In the new probe design the reference reflection is provided by a zero-degree cleaved fiber end and the transmitted beam is focused by a gradient-index lens. The fiber probe will have applications in biology and engineering.
